Widget HTML #1

Choosing the Right Business CRM: Key Factors Every Company Should Consider

In today’s increasingly competitive and customer-driven business environment, choosing the right Business CRM is no longer a purely technical decision—it is a strategic one. Customer Relationship Management (CRM) systems sit at the heart of modern organizations, influencing how companies attract leads, manage sales pipelines, deliver marketing campaigns, support customers, and make data-driven decisions. Selecting the wrong CRM can lead to low user adoption, wasted budgets, fragmented data, and missed growth opportunities. On the other hand, choosing the right business CRM can become a powerful catalyst for efficiency, scalability, and long-term success.


As businesses grow and evolve, their needs become more complex. What works for a small startup may not suit a scaling company or an established enterprise. With hundreds of CRM solutions available—ranging from simple contact management tools to advanced, AI-powered platforms—making the right choice can feel overwhelming. Features, pricing models, integrations, usability, security, and scalability all play critical roles in determining whether a CRM system will truly support business goals.

This comprehensive guide explores the key factors every company should consider when choosing the right business CRM. It provides in-depth explanations, practical examples, and actionable recommendations that decision-makers can apply directly. Written in clear, professional, and SEO-friendly English, this article is designed for business owners, executives, managers, and teams seeking to invest in a CRM solution that aligns with their strategy, supports growth, and delivers long-term value.

Understanding What a Business CRM Really Is

Defining Business CRM in the Modern Context

A Business CRM is a software system designed to manage a company’s interactions with current and potential customers across the entire customer lifecycle. While early CRM tools focused mainly on storing contact information, modern CRM platforms integrate sales, marketing, customer service, analytics, automation, and data management into a single system.

Today’s business CRM software acts as a centralized hub where customer data is collected, organized, analyzed, and transformed into actionable insights. It supports relationship building, operational efficiency, and strategic decision-making across departments.

Why CRM Is a Strategic Business Investment

A CRM system directly affects revenue generation, customer satisfaction, team productivity, and operational transparency. Choosing the right CRM is not just about software features—it is about selecting a platform that supports business strategy and enables sustainable growth.

Companies that view CRM as a strategic investment, rather than a tactical tool, are more likely to achieve high adoption rates and measurable returns.

Common Misconceptions About CRM Selection

Many organizations believe that the most popular or most feature-rich CRM is automatically the best choice. Others assume that CRM selection is primarily an IT decision. In reality, CRM success depends on alignment with business processes, user needs, and long-term goals.

Understanding what CRM is—and what it is not—is the first step toward making the right choice.

Clarifying Business Goals Before Choosing a CRM

Why Business Objectives Must Drive CRM Selection

Before evaluating CRM vendors or features, companies must clearly define their business objectives. A CRM system should support specific goals, such as increasing sales conversion rates, improving customer retention, enhancing marketing efficiency, or gaining better data visibility.

Without clear objectives, CRM selection becomes unfocused and reactive, increasing the risk of choosing a system that does not deliver value.

Identifying Primary Use Cases

Different organizations use CRM systems in different ways. Some focus primarily on sales pipeline management, while others prioritize marketing automation or customer service excellence. Many companies require a balanced approach across multiple functions.

Defining primary and secondary use cases helps narrow down CRM options and avoid unnecessary complexity.

Aligning CRM Goals with Growth Strategy

A growing company may need a CRM that supports scalability, automation, and integration, while a mature enterprise may prioritize advanced analytics and customization. CRM selection should reflect where the business is today and where it plans to be in the future.

Growth alignment ensures long-term relevance.

Practical Tip for Goal Definition

Document clear CRM success metrics, such as reduced sales cycle length, higher lead conversion rates, or improved customer satisfaction scores, before starting the selection process.

Understanding Your Business Size and Complexity

CRM Needs for Small Businesses

Small businesses often need CRM systems that are easy to use, quick to implement, and cost-effective. Simplicity, affordability, and core functionality are usually more important than advanced customization.

For small teams, a lightweight business CRM that focuses on contact management, basic sales tracking, and simple automation may be sufficient.

CRM Considerations for Growing Companies

As companies scale, CRM requirements become more complex. Growing businesses need systems that support larger teams, more data, multiple pipelines, and deeper analytics. Integration with marketing tools, customer support systems, and accounting software becomes increasingly important.

Scalability and flexibility are critical factors for growing organizations.

CRM Requirements for Enterprises

Enterprise organizations often require advanced customization, role-based access controls, complex workflows, and enterprise-grade security. They may also need CRM solutions that support global operations and regulatory compliance.

Enterprise CRM selection involves balancing power with usability.

Practical Tip for Sizing

Choose a CRM that fits your current needs but can scale with your business without requiring a complete system replacement.

Ease of Use and User Adoption

Why Usability Is One of the Most Critical Factors

A CRM system is only effective if people actually use it. Even the most powerful CRM will fail if it is too complex, unintuitive, or time-consuming for users. Ease of use directly impacts adoption rates, data quality, and return on investment.

User-friendly CRM systems reduce training time and encourage consistent usage.

Evaluating User Interface and Experience

When evaluating CRM options, companies should assess the interface from the perspective of daily users. Is navigation intuitive? Are key tasks easy to complete? Does the system reduce or increase administrative work?

A clean, logical interface supports productivity.

Mobile Accessibility and Remote Work

Modern businesses increasingly rely on mobile and remote work. A good business CRM should offer mobile access and responsive design, allowing teams to work effectively from anywhere.

Mobility enhances flexibility and responsiveness.

Practical Tip for Adoption

Involve end users in CRM demos and trials to gather feedback before making a final decision.

Customization and Flexibility

Adapting CRM to Your Business Processes

No two businesses operate exactly the same way. A good CRM should be customizable to reflect unique workflows, sales stages, fields, and reporting requirements.

Customization ensures that CRM supports the business rather than forcing the business to adapt to the software.

Balancing Customization and Complexity

While customization is important, excessive customization can make CRM systems difficult to maintain and upgrade. Companies should look for CRMs that offer flexible configuration without requiring extensive coding.

Balance is key to long-term success.

Supporting Process Evolution

As businesses grow, processes evolve. CRM systems should allow changes to workflows, automation rules, and data structures without major disruptions.

Flexibility supports adaptability.

Practical Tip for Customization

Prioritize configurable options over hard-coded custom development whenever possible.

Integration with Existing Tools and Systems

Why Integration Matters in CRM Selection

Business CRM systems rarely operate in isolation. They must integrate with email platforms, marketing automation tools, customer support systems, accounting software, and other business applications.

Strong integration capabilities reduce data silos and manual work.

Evaluating Native Integrations and APIs

Some CRM platforms offer extensive native integrations, while others rely on APIs or third-party connectors. Companies should evaluate whether the CRM integrates easily with their existing tech stack.

Integration ease affects implementation speed and cost.

Data Synchronization and Consistency

Integration should ensure real-time or near-real-time data synchronization across systems. Inconsistent data undermines trust and decision-making.

Consistency is critical for data-driven strategies.

Practical Tip for Integration Planning

List all essential tools your business uses and verify CRM compatibility before making a decision.

Automation Capabilities

The Role of Automation in Modern CRM

Automation is one of the most valuable features of modern business CRM systems. It reduces manual work, improves consistency, and increases efficiency across sales, marketing, and customer service.

Automation transforms CRM from a passive database into an active workflow engine.

Sales and Marketing Automation

CRM automation can handle lead assignment, follow-up reminders, email sequences, pipeline updates, and campaign execution. These features free teams to focus on high-value activities.

Efficiency drives productivity.

Customer Service Automation

Automation in customer support includes ticket routing, SLA tracking, knowledge base suggestions, and feedback collection.

Automation improves response times and service quality.

Practical Tip for Automation Evaluation

Assess whether automation tools are intuitive and flexible enough for non-technical users.

Reporting, Analytics, and Data-Driven Insights

Why Analytics Should Be a Core CRM Consideration

One of the primary reasons businesses invest in CRM is to gain better visibility into performance and customer behavior. Reporting and analytics capabilities determine how effectively data can be turned into insights.

Good analytics support better decisions.

Standard Reports vs Custom Dashboards

Some CRM systems offer predefined reports, while others allow extensive customization. Companies should evaluate whether reporting options align with their KPIs and decision-making needs.

Customization increases relevance.

Real-Time Data and Forecasting

Real-time dashboards and predictive analytics enhance responsiveness and planning accuracy.

Speed matters in competitive markets.

Practical Tip for Analytics

Choose a CRM that allows role-based dashboards so different teams see relevant insights.

Scalability and Long-Term Growth Potential

Supporting Business Expansion

A CRM system should support increasing data volumes, user numbers, and functional complexity as the business grows. Scalability ensures that the system remains effective over time.

Growth readiness prevents costly migrations.

Adding New Teams and Functions

As businesses expand, new departments may need access to CRM. The system should support role-based access and flexible permissions.

Controlled access ensures security.

Global and Multi-Location Support

For companies with international ambitions, CRM should support multiple currencies, languages, and time zones.

Global readiness supports expansion.

Practical Tip for Scalability

Ask CRM vendors about their largest customers and typical growth paths.

Security, Privacy, and Compliance

Protecting Customer Data

CRM systems store sensitive customer and business data. Security features such as encryption, access controls, and audit logs are essential.

Trust depends on security.

Compliance with Regulations

Businesses must comply with data protection regulations such as GDPR or industry-specific standards. CRM systems should support compliance requirements.

Compliance reduces risk.

Vendor Reliability and Data Ownership

Companies should understand where data is stored, who owns it, and how it can be exported if needed.

Transparency builds confidence.

Practical Tip for Security Assessment

Review CRM security certifications and documentation before purchase.

Pricing Models and Total Cost of Ownership

Understanding CRM Pricing Structures

CRM pricing may be based on users, features, data volume, or usage. Subscription models are common, but costs can add up over time.

Understanding pricing prevents surprises.

Hidden Costs to Watch For

Implementation, customization, training, integrations, and support may involve additional costs.

Total cost of ownership matters more than initial price.

Aligning Cost with Value

The right CRM should deliver measurable value that justifies its cost. Cheap solutions may become expensive if they fail to meet needs.

Value drives ROI.

Practical Tip for Budgeting

Calculate costs over a three- to five-year period when comparing CRM options.

Vendor Reputation and Support

Importance of Vendor Reliability

CRM is a long-term investment. Choosing a stable and reputable vendor reduces risk.

Vendor longevity matters.

Quality of Customer Support

Responsive and knowledgeable support is critical, especially during implementation and scaling.

Support affects success.

Training and Onboarding Resources

Vendors that offer training, documentation, and onboarding assistance help ensure smooth adoption.

Education drives usage.

Practical Tip for Vendor Evaluation

Read customer reviews and case studies from similar businesses.

Implementation and Change Management

Planning for Successful CRM Implementation

Implementation success depends on clear planning, stakeholder involvement, and realistic timelines.

Preparation reduces disruption.

Managing Organizational Change

CRM adoption often requires changes in processes and behavior. Change management is essential to overcome resistance.

People drive success.

Measuring Implementation Success

Clear milestones and KPIs help track progress and identify issues early.

Measurement supports accountability.

Practical Tip for Implementation

Assign a CRM owner or champion within the organization.

Common Mistakes to Avoid When Choosing a Business CRM

Choosing Based on Features Alone

More features do not guarantee better outcomes. Relevance matters more than quantity.

Focus on fit.

Ignoring User Feedback

Excluding end users leads to low adoption.

Involvement improves success.

Underestimating Data Migration Challenges

Migrating data from old systems requires careful planning.

Preparation prevents data loss.

Overlooking Long-Term Needs

Short-term thinking leads to frequent system changes.

Plan for the future.

Best Practices for Choosing the Right Business CRM

Follow a Structured Evaluation Process

Define requirements, shortlist vendors, conduct demos, and test solutions systematically.

Structure improves decisions.

Involve Cross-Functional Stakeholders

Sales, marketing, support, IT, and leadership should all have input.

Diverse perspectives improve fit.

Pilot Before Full Rollout

Testing CRM with a small group reduces risk.

Pilots provide insights.

Document Decisions and Rationale

Clear documentation supports alignment and accountability.

Clarity matters.

The Future of Business CRM and Why Choice Matters More Than Ever

CRM as a Strategic Platform

CRM systems are becoming central platforms for customer experience, analytics, and automation.

Strategic importance is increasing.

AI and Advanced Capabilities

Future CRM systems will leverage AI for predictive insights, personalization, and decision support.

Future readiness matters.

Continuous Evolution

Choosing the right CRM today positions businesses to adopt future innovations seamlessly.

Adaptability ensures longevity.

Making the Right Business CRM Choice for Long-Term Success

Choosing the right business CRM is one of the most important technology decisions a company can make. It affects how teams work, how customers are served, and how decisions are made. A well-chosen CRM supports productivity, data-driven insights, scalability, and customer-centric growth.

By carefully considering business goals, usability, customization, integration, automation, analytics, security, and vendor support, companies can select a CRM system that truly aligns with their needs. Avoiding common pitfalls and following best practices ensures that CRM becomes a strategic asset rather than a costly burden.

In an era where customer relationships define competitive advantage, the right business CRM provides clarity, structure, and intelligence. Companies that invest time and thought into CRM selection are better positioned to grow, adapt, and succeed in an increasingly complex business world.